MyWebsolution - PHP Loginsysten

Vorwort

Dieses Loginsystem stellt lediglich eine Demo für das PHP Loginsystem Tutorial von MyWebsolution dar. Es gibt unter anderem eine Übersicht darüber, wie die unterschiedliche Skripte benannt werden und wie sie zusammenarbeiten. Ein produktiver Einsatz ist nicht zu empfehlen, da das Loginsystem

  1. Öffentlich zugänglich ist (Sicherheit)
  2. lediglich ein Beispiel darstellt
  3. die Funktionalitäten nicht 100% geprüft sind

Wer sich entgegen dieser Warnungen dennoch für einen produktiven Einsatz entscheidet, tut dies auf eigene Gefahr und kann MyWebsolution in keiner Weise dafür haftbar machen.

Benutzt das Beispiel also dazu, wozu es gemacht ist: Zum Lernen und Verstehen :)

Installation

Die Installation läuft in 2 Schritten ab:

  1. Konfigurieren der MySQL-Datenbankverbindungsdaten
  2. Ausführen der Datei setup.php

MySQL Datenbankkonfiguration

Zum Konfigurieren der MySQL Datenbank öffnet bitte die Datei mysql.php mit einem Texteditor eurer Wahl und tragt dort die Zugangsdaten zu eurer MySQL Datenbank ein. Falls ihr Probleme damit habt, schaut bitte meinen Tipp zum Herstellen einer MySQL Datenbankverbindung an.

Setup

Nachdem ihr eure Daten für die MySQL Verbindung eingetragen habt, klickt bitte auf diesem Link: Setup des PHP Loginsystems

Menu

Zu guter Letzt folgt nun eine Auflistung der Skripte inklusive einer kurzen Beschreibung:

Registrierung
Registrierungsformular zum Registrieren neuer User ("registrierung.php)
Login
Loginformular zum Einloggen (login.php)
Logout
"Logoutbutton" (logout.php)
Userliste
Auflistung aller registrierten User (userliste.php)
Mein Profil
Das eigene Profil zum editieren ("myprofil.php)
Adminbereich
Registrierungsformular zum Registrieren neuer User (admin/index.php)